US 7,481,741 B1
Ladder and related methods
Charles C. Sammann, Amarillo, Tex. (US); Trace A. McGuire, Amarillo, Tex. (US); and Richard Hefley, Amarillo, Tex. (US)
Assigned to Backyard Leisure Holdings, Inc., Pittsburg, Kans. (US)
Filed on Jun. 27, 2006, as Appl. No. 11/475,662.
Int. Cl. A63B 9/00 (2006.01)
U.S. Cl. 482—35  [482/37] 9 Claims
OG exemplary drawing
 
1. A ladder for playground equipment comprising:
a plurality of support members;
a first lateral support member and a second lateral support member spaced apart from each other, the first lateral support member and the second lateral support member each having substantially the same size and shape so as to be interchangeable, each lateral support member includes a plurality of corresponding elongated sockets spaced along the length of opposite sides of each lateral support member thereby permitting support members to be received on opposite sides of the first and second lateral support member, each socket configured to receive one end of one of the plurality of support members such that the plurality of support members are positioned therebetween to form the ladder, each socket configured to position each support member horizontally when the lateral support members are positioned at an angle other than perpendicular to the playground equipment, the support members held in place by a support member securing means, wherein a cap member is positioned at the top end of each lateral support member, the cap member includes a body portion, and an arm extending outward from an upper section and a lower section of the body portion to contact a horizontal surface of the playground equipment to secure the lateral support member to the playground equipment by a lateral support member securing means extending though an orifice in the arm, wherein each cap member includes a stop lip having a first surface and a second surface, the stop lip positioned between the lateral support member and the arm and extending outward from the body portion, the first surface of the stop lip configured to contact a generally vertical surface of the playground equipment, the second surface of first stop lip configured to position the lateral support member a distance from the playground equipment.
